A virtual data room (VDR) lets businesses securely share documents with third parties. They are usually used during due diligence processes in an enterprise transaction, but they can also be utilized to store a large amount of company documents for use by internal teams.

It is essential to consider the storage capacity as well as the features you need for your project when selecting a VDR. Calculators can be available on the site of the vendor to determine how much space you’ll require. Text documents take up less storage space than high-res images or technical drawings.

Online data rooms are usually employed in M&A transactions however, they can be used for other purposes. For example Life science companies usually require sharing confidential documents with potential investors. Details about the development of products as well as financial performance and patents can be included. The best VDRs provide enterprise-grade handles to safeguard sensitive files from any unauthorized access. Users can also make an access accord for sensitive files and add watermarks to prevent the sharing of documents and file modification. Some vendors provide 24/7 customer support and an expert team that will answer your questions or offer assistance regarding any other aspect of the VDR program.
